SDK TypeScript
Comptes bancaires
Lister les comptes bancaires et consulter les soldes
Accès via client.bankAccounts.
list
Lister les comptes bancaires.
// Comptes actifs uniquement
const accounts = await client.bankAccounts.list(true);
// Tous les comptes (actifs et inactifs)
const all = await client.bankAccounts.list();| Paramètre | Type | Défaut | Description |
|---|---|---|---|
enabled | boolean | — | Filtrer par statut (true = actifs uniquement) |
Retour : Promise<BankAccount[]>
get
Récupérer les détails d'un compte bancaire.
const account = await client.bankAccounts.get(123);| Paramètre | Type | Description |
|---|---|---|
bankAccountId | number | ID du compte |
Retour : Promise<BankAccount>
balance
Récupérer les soldes de tous les comptes actifs.
const balances = await client.bankAccounts.balance();
// [{ name: "Compte courant", balance_amount: 15420.50, currency: "EUR" }]Retour : Promise<Array<{ name: string, balance_amount: number, currency: string }>>
Type BankAccount
| Champ | Type | Description |
|---|---|---|
id | number | Identifiant unique |
name | string | Nom du compte |
bank | Bank | Banque associée |
bank_account_type | { id, code, description } | Type de compte |
iban | string | IBAN |
bic | string | BIC |
enabled | boolean | Compte actif |
balance_amount | number | Solde |
balance_currency | string | Devise du solde |
balance_date | string | Date du solde |
is_wallet | boolean | Compte wallet |
closed | boolean | Compte clôturé |
synchronization_date | string | Date de dernière synchronisation |
Type Bank
| Champ | Type | Description |
|---|---|---|
id | number | Identifiant unique |
name | string | Nom de la banque |
brand | string | Marque |
sigle | string | Sigle |
code | string | Code banque |
logo_url | string | URL du logo |